Cherry Street Joins Ballina Jockey Club As Cup Sponsor

The Ballina Jockey Club is excited to announce a new sponsor for the Ballina Cup, connecting with the Cherry Street Sports Group as the naming rights partner of the $65,000 Ballina Cup, to be run on Friday, January 13, 2023.

Club Chairman David Daniel said: “The Cherry Street Sports Group are an excellent local organisation with connections in both Ballina and Lennox Head, where they are well known for their community support, as well as their family-friendly hospitality. We see a lot of synergy between our businesses, and we are proud to form what we hope will be a long-term relationship.”

Cherry Street Sports Group General Manager Tere Sheean said: “Cherry Street Sports Group is excited to have the opportunity of sponsoring the Ballina Cup. We have a large local membership and look forward to building value into their support of our Clubs, the Cherry Street Sports and Club Lennox Sports. We are particularly excited to work collaboratively with the Ballina Jockey Club in a variety of ways in a bid to help bring economic growth to the region. The Ballina Cup is an iconic annual community event with over 100 years of local history."

Ballina Jockey Club General Manager Matthew Bertram added: “The Cherry Street Sports Group are a dynamic and progressive Club organisation who are growing at an exponential rate. We are excited to join forces to provide entertainment to our members and the greater Northern Rivers communities. We will commence with the Cherry Street Sports Group Ballina Cup this January 2023, and we have plans for many more events to follow.

“Both Clubs value their members and community and look forward to partnering in ways that will promote the region. Ballina and Lennox Head are already two of NSW most sought-after tourist destinations. We look forward to showcasing more of what makes this region so popular.”

“Having the Racing NSW Big Dance qualifying status adds to our vision. The $2 Million Big Dance concept and success will help attract participants from far and wide and various qualifiers from all over the state. There is no better tourist destination than the Ballina/Lennox/Byron Coastline. We expect the Cherry Street Sports Group Ballina Cup will become one of the best examples of the Big Dance qualifier concept for years to come.”

With just seven days to go before the Cherry Street Sports Group Ballina Cup 2023, tickets can be purchased online via the www.ballinajockeyclub.com.au.

The celebrations start on Cup Eve with the Cherry Street Sports Group Ballina Cup Calcutta - to be held at Cherry Street Sports in Ballina, from 7 pm on Thursday, January 12.
